Inflation Concerns Mount Amid Energy Shock
Surging global oil prices, attributed to an energy shock in the Middle East, are intensifying inflation risks and triggering a sell-off in the global bond market. Concurrently, Japan's wholesale inflation remained elevated in August, adding pressure on the Bank of Japan to consider an interest rate hike.
US Dollar Holds Gains in Volatile Trade
The U.S. dollar retained its strength as investors navigated market uncertainty stemming from the Mideast energy situation. The dollar's resilience was notable as other currencies, including the Japanese yen, weakened despite growing expectations for a potential rate increase in Japan.
Geopolitical and Financial Risks on the Radar
Market participants are monitoring developing geopolitical and financial risks that could introduce volatility. Reports have emerged that sanctions may be announced against a large, unnamed bank, adding a layer of uncertainty to the financial sector.
